Right the linked topic:

From memory so im not 100% sure

1.remove the crown[two screws either side and a retainer ring on top]

2.remove the preload/rebound adjusters[little grub screw on the side]

3.remove the little circlips on top of the caps[dont lose these]

4.grip the slider in one hand and undo the top cap on the non rebound side with a 26mm spanner

5.pull out the spring + put it on an old cloth

6.turn the fork upside down and drain the oil into a suitable jug

7.repeat steps 4,5+6 on the other leg[while its upside down ,pump the rebound rod in and out to clear all of the oil from the rebound cartridge]

8.dont undo the nuts underneath the fork tubes .If you only want to replace the oil ,leave them in place.

9.replace the oil[sorry this is the bit im unsure of i cant remember the exact grade they recommend]

10.pour in the oil into each leg[slowly]till the level is about 40mm from the top of the stanchion[extend the stanchion fully]

11.pump the rebound rod up and down so that it fills with oil and theres no air left

12.top up to the 40mm from the top level [after pumping the rebound you will need a little more oil in that leg than the non rebound leg]

13.reassemble and dont forget those circlips

Right well I did this and you don't need to remove the little adjusters on the top, just to let people know.
